Topological Interlocking Sunscreens
Louisiana State University
2019
Description: The intent of this project is to design and prototype a sunscreen made of topological interlocking blocks. The screen is a self-standing structure and will not be attached to another structure. Thus, each row should support the weight of the blocks on top of it. Both sides of the screen are exposed to pedestrians and it should allow view from one side to the other. Also, it should provide lateral resistance. The topological interlocking blocks are aggregated without using any mortar. One module needs to be designed to then be aggregated to make an assembly.
